Output 17c3e52a9c29d3b18a6a21b1f6f38a6c38e6f5b50ff8c61cf2ba85ae81c80a24:4

value
37268887
script pubkey
OP_0 OP_PUSHBYTES_20 0f20e6df0de1a30153d1cb2187608450a591120e
address
bc1qpuswdhcdux3sz573evscwcyy2zjezysw6xadag
transaction
17c3e52a9c29d3b18a6a21b1f6f38a6c38e6f5b50ff8c61cf2ba85ae81c80a24
confirmations
103154
spent
true